Region I-1A

The dynasty continues for the Wildorado boys golf team as the Mustangs were able to secure yet another title by winning the Region I-1A championship Monday and Tuesday at the Meadowbrook Golf Club in Lubbock.

This is the unprecedented fourth straight regional championship for the Mustangs, who have won the UIL Class 1A state championship two of the last three years.

The Mustangs shot a 36-hole team score of 706, firing a 347 on Monday followed by a 359 on Tuesday to hold off second place Springlake-Earth (367-345 – 712) by six strokes. Whitharral (712) came in third as a team to also qualify for state.
